In the summer of 2019, Benjamin Taylor covered the role of Zurga in The Pearl Fishers with Santa Fe Opera. He is a former Resident Artist with Pittsburgh Opera, where his roles last season included Schaunard in La Bohème, Yamadori in Madama Butterfly, and Older Thompson in Tom Cipullo’s Glory Denied. Last season’s appearances also included a debut with Madison Opera as Silvio in Pagliacci.

In the 2017/18 season, his roles in Pittsburgh included the leading role of Brian in Jeremy Howard Beck’s The Long Walk, and he also appeared as Sciarrone in Tosca and Captain Gardiner in Moby-Dick.

He previously was a Gerdine Young Artist with Opera Theatre of Saint Louis, where he performed Fiorello in The Barber of Seville, Cowardly Giant in Jack Perla’s Shalimar the Clown, and Yamadori in Madama Butterfly. In 2016, he performed Marcello in La Bohème with Colorado’s Crested Butte Music Festival and Yamadori in Madama Butterfly with Berkshire Opera. (BenjaminCTaylor.com)
